In the South Gobi, one of Mongolia’s leading privately-owned mining and industrial groups, Mongolyn Alt Corporation (MAK), is taking a decisive step toward lower-emission, technology-driven mining. At its Naryn Sukhait operation, the company recently commissioned two fully electric Sandvik DR412iE rotary blasthole drill rigs, marking a shift not just in equipment, but in how drilling performance is delivered.

MAK’s ‘30 Years Towards a Green Future’ program was introduced in 2023, as the company marked its 30th anniversary and redefined its long-term development direction for the next three decades.

Initiated by President and CEO, Tselmuun Nyamtaishir, the program serves as a group-wide platform to accelerate MAK’s green transition by integrating sustainable and energy-efficient technologies, including the phased electrification of mining and industrial equipment, the deployment of renewable energy and the adoption of solutions that reduce emissions while improving operational efficiency.

A strategic shift to electric

MAK and Sandvik have worked together since 2010, with MAK operating D45KS and D75KS drill rigs at its Naryn Sukhait operation. The introduction of the DR412iE rigs represents a step change, from conventional diesel-powered equipment to a fully electric, automation-ready platform.

“We have been cooperating with Sandvik since 2010,” said Lamzav Bayarmunkh, Chief Engineer at Naryn Sukhait. “We use Sandvik D45KS and D75KS drills which we are slowly retiring. Since late 2025, or early 2026, we have introduced two DR412iE units into operation.”

For MAK, electrification is not just about equipment; it’s part of a broader operational philosophy. “The main reason for choosing the electric DR412iE drills is that they’re in line with our policy aimed at green development,” Bayarmunkh explained.

The commissioning of the Sandvik DR412iE drills is among the first major operational steps under this agenda, translating MAK’s group-level sustainability policy into measurable change at site level. By moving from diesel-powered drilling to an electric, automation-ready platform, the company is linking environmental performance with higher productivity, safer working conditions and a more modern mining model.

Performance driven by design

The DR412iE, part of Sandvik’s iSeries rotary drills range, is engineered to deliver high-capacity drilling with the benefits of electrification and digitalization. For MAK, the results have been immediate. “We have been using the Sandvik DR412iE electric drill for about three to four months,” said Bayarmunkh. “The main advantage is that they’re fully electric. They also perform single-pass drilling, which significantly improves productivity.”

Compared with previous equipment, the productivity gains are clear. “Earlier drills achieved 20 to 25 meters-per-hour, whereas the Sandvik DR412iE achieves 30 to 40 meters-per-hour,” he noted. Shift output has also increased substantially. “Currently, the DR412iE drills achieve around 700 to 800 meters-per-shift, which is significantly higher than previous drills,” Bayarmunkh added.

These improvements are supported by design features that optimize uptime and efficiency, including the ability to move between holes without lowering the mast and automated cable handling.

“The DR412iE can move without lowering the mast, saving time, and it automatically reels and unreels its cable,” Bayarmunkh said. “Another advantage is that it eliminates the need for an operator’s assistant – the new model can be operated by one person, rather than two as with the D75KS and D45KS.”

Digital capability at the core

Beyond electrification, the DR412iE introduces a new level of digital integration. Equipped with GPS and supported by Sandvik’s DRI platform, the rig enables more precise and efficient drilling.

“The drill is equipped with TIM3D high-precision navigation, enabling accurate positioning of the drill rig,” said Bayarmunkh. This allows drilling to the correct elevation, resulting in a cleaner bench after blasting and improved fragmentation. At the same time, connectivity through Sandvik’s digital ecosystem provides real-time operational insight.

“With My Sandvik Productivity, we can fully monitor the drill’s performance and maintenance,” he explained. Together, these capabilities support a more data-driven approach to drilling, where performance, maintenance and optimization are increasingly interconnected.

Designed around the operator

While productivity and sustainability are key drivers, operator experience has also been a major focus. The DR412iE cabin design and ergonomics reflect a shift toward safer, more comfortable working environments. “Operators have very positive feedback,” said Bayarmunkh. “The cabin is spacious, tools are easily accessible, and the working conditions are comfortable and safe.”

Noise reduction and improved insulation further enhance the experience. “The cabin is well insulated, so external noise is minimal,” he added. The rig also supports on-the-job training, with space for instructors to sit alongside and support operators. This helps accelerate skills development as new technology is introduced.

Building momentum in electrification

For MAK, the DR412iE is part of a broader transition toward electrified and lower-emission operations. “As part of our ‘30 Years Towards a Green Future’ program, we’re introducing more electric equipment into our operations,” said Bayarmunkh. “The Sandvik DR412iE drills are just the starting point.”

At Naryn Sukhait, the early results highlight a wider industry shift: electrification is no longer a future ambition, but a practical pathway to improving productivity, reducing emissions and modernizing mining operations. MAK is already expanding this approach beyond drilling, with electric buses and other technologies being introduced across the site.

This transition is also evident across the company’s manufacturing operations. Under the leadership of President N. Tselmuun, MAK Group has begun sourcing approximately 40–60 percent of the total energy consumption of its three European-standard building materials plants from solar power.

Together, these initiatives demonstrate MAK’s broader commitment to building a cleaner, more efficient and future-ready industrial model for Mongolia, while contributing to the advancement of environmental, social and governance (ESG) principles, the United Nations Sustainable Development Goals, and the broader sustainability agenda across Mongolia and Southeast Asia.
